srv_revert_to_self (API de procedimiento almacenado extendido)

Finaliza la suplantación de una aplicación cliente.

Sintaxis

BOOL srv_revert_to_self (SRV_PROC * srvproc);

Argumentos

  • srvproc
    Es un puntero a la estructura SRV_PROC que es el identificador de una conexión cliente determinada. La estructura contiene toda la información que la biblioteca de API Procedimiento almacenado extendido usa para administrar las comunicaciones y los datos entre la aplicación y el cliente.

Devuelve

true cuando el procedimiento almacenado finaliza correctamente la suplantación; en caso contrario, false.

Notas

Un procedimiento almacenado extendido debe llamar a srv_revert_to_self después de finalizar las suplantaciones iniciadas mediante srv_impersonate_client (API de procedimiento almacenado extendido).

Si srv_revert_to_self produce un error, la aplicación continúa ejecutándose en el contexto del cliente. Es posible que esto no sea lo más apropiado. Cuando srv_revert_to_self produce un error, se debe cerrar el proceso.

Vea también

Otros recursos